CHICAGO – In 1963, Judy Garland had a CBS-TV variety series, and in December there was a Christmas episode featuring her kids … including Liza Minnelli. Playwright Desiree Burcum and the comedy troupe FAMOUS IN THE FUTURE have created (click link) ”A Judy Christmas” as a stage play.

Submitted by PatrickMcD on November 16, 2023 - 10:20amCHICAGO – It was another city in another time when Andrew Davis directed his first film “Stony Island” in 1970s Chicago. The film was released in 1978 to acclaim, but faded into the mist of cinema. Submitted by PatrickMcD on October 18, 2023 - 2:07pmCHICAGO – Stand-up comic Liz Miele is a true comedy veteran, even in her current youth. She began her career at age 16 and has kept up with the evolution of both comedy and reaching an audience, as evidenced by her YouTube specials garnering millions of views.
